This article is about the pirate. For the cat, see Del-Monty.

Dell Monti is a pirate that was added with the Personalised Shops update on 2 September 2009. He is located in Brimhaven, around the POH portal. He will give 40 free noted pineapples to those who have completed the easy Karamja Tasks, but only once a day (You do not need to wear the Karamja gloves). He will also give 40 free noted apples to those who have completed the elite Karamja Tasks. Unlike Bert, Dell does not directly transfer the pineapples into the players bank.

Trivia

  • Dell's name, like that of the cat Del-Monty, is a play on the American food production company Del Monte. They are probably most famous for their tinned fruit, especially pineapples.
  • When asked about his parrot, Dell will say that it kept telling him to "Pick up a penguin." This is a reference to the Penguin chocolate bar advertising campaign.
  • Around the time of release, the price of pineapples dropped sharply from 450 coins each to less than 100 coins due to an increase in supply. Players no longer needed to buy materials for supercompost if they could just get it for free. This also drove down the price of other supercompostable materials like calquat, mushrooms, and coconut shells.
